Transaction 5bab77fe2fd7500aecbf7088bbfbf3ece451c258f77928c69ca88b2f7d091398
1 Input
1 Output
-
5bab77fe2fd7500aecbf7088bbfbf3ece451c258f77928c69ca88b2f7d091398:0
- value
- 500587228
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 85a6015bd4a2dda95a25737ee50c0112b67e5f09 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DBfjmLW9PVZLFbsjCmtf4P79GRXygqmuu